Hexahydrocannabinol (HHC) is a hydrogenated type of THC, a cannabinoid discovered naturally within the hashish plant, although usually produced synthetically. Questions concerning its detection in customary drug screenings are prevalent as a consequence of its structural similarity to THC and its rising availability. The first concern is whether or not the metabolites produced after HHC consumption can set off a optimistic consequence.
The importance of understanding the detection capabilities of drug exams lies in varied domains. Employment, authorized proceedings, and athletic competitions usually require people to endure screening for managed substances. A optimistic consequence can have important repercussions. Realizing whether or not HHC use will result in such a result’s due to this fact essential for people in these conditions. Traditionally, drug testing has centered on THC and its main metabolite, THCCOOH, resulting in uncertainty about how novel cannabinoids like HHC are processed and detected.
This evaluation will delve into the metabolic pathways of HHC, study the cross-reactivity of ordinary drug exams with HHC metabolites, and discover present scientific understanding of its detectability. The restrictions of present testing methodologies and the potential for future developments in cannabinoid detection may also be addressed.

2. Cross-reactivity
Cross-reactivity is a pivotal consider figuring out whether or not HHC consumption results in a optimistic drug take a look at consequence. It refers back to the skill of antibodies utilized in drug screening immunoassays to bind to substances aside from the precise goal analyte, on this case, THC metabolites. The structural similarity between HHC metabolites and THCCOOH can lead to such cross-reactivity, probably resulting in false optimistic outcomes.
-
Antibody Specificity and Affinity
Drug take a look at immunoassays depend on antibodies designed to bind with excessive specificity to THC metabolites like THCCOOH. Nonetheless, these antibodies could exhibit a point of affinity for molecules with comparable chemical buildings. If HHC metabolites possess ample structural similarity to THCCOOH, they will bind to those antibodies, triggering a optimistic sign. The extent of this cross-reactivity relies on the precise antibody used and the focus of HHC metabolites current within the pattern.

7. Sort of take a look at
The particular kind of drug take a look at employed is a vital determinant of whether or not HHC consumption is detected. Completely different testing methodologies possess various sensitivities, specificities, and detection home windows, instantly affecting their skill to determine HHC metabolites. The selection of take a look at, due to this fact, establishes the elemental risk of detecting HHC use. For instance, a urine immunoassay, a standard preliminary screening methodology, could exhibit cross-reactivity with HHC metabolites, resulting in a presumptive optimistic. Nonetheless, the identical pattern analyzed through fuel chromatography-mass spectrometry (GC-MS) may precisely differentiate between HHC and THC metabolites, leading to a destructive or inconclusive discovering. Thus, the inherent limitations and capabilities of every testing methodology create a direct cause-and-effect relationship with the take a look at consequence.
Immunoassays, whereas fast and cost-effective, are vulnerable to cross-reactivity and usually present a decrease diploma of specificity in comparison with confirmatory exams like GC-MS or liquid chromatography-mass spectrometry (LC-MS). These superior strategies separate and determine particular person compounds with excessive precision, minimizing the chance of false positives as a consequence of structurally comparable substances. Moreover, hair follicle testing, identified for its prolonged detection window, may reveal power HHC use even when latest urine or blood exams are destructive. It is because hair incorporates substances over an extended interval, offering a historic document of drug publicity. Conversely, saliva exams sometimes have the shortest detection window, making them appropriate just for figuring out very latest HHC use. The sensible significance of understanding these variations lies in deciding on the suitable take a look at primarily based on particular wants and circumstances, corresponding to pre-employment screening, forensic investigations, or office monitoring.

8. False positives
The potential for false optimistic outcomes constitutes a major concern when evaluating whether or not HHC consumption results in detection in drug exams. A false optimistic happens when a drug screening signifies the presence of a prohibited substance when, in actuality, the person has not used that particular substance. Within the context of HHC, the first mechanism for false positives stems from cross-reactivity between HHC metabolites and the antibodies utilized in immunoassays designed to detect THC metabolites. If HHC metabolites share ample structural similarity with THCCOOH, the goal analyte for a lot of customary drug exams, they will bind to the antibodies, triggering a optimistic sign. That is essential since a person could take a look at optimistic with out having consumed THC, resulting in potential authorized, employment, or social repercussions.
Actual-world examples spotlight the potential penalties of false positives associated to HHC. An worker subjected to random drug testing may face disciplinary motion or termination primarily based on a false optimistic consequence stemming from HHC use. Equally, an athlete may very well be disqualified from competitors, or a person concerned in authorized proceedings may face unjust penalties. The sensible significance of understanding the potential for false positives lies within the want for confirmatory testing. When an preliminary screening yields a optimistic consequence, confirmatory strategies corresponding to GC-MS or LC-MS are essential to differentiate between HHC and THC metabolites, offering a extra correct evaluation of precise substance use. These confirmatory exams scale back the chance of inaccurate conclusions and assist mitigate the opposed penalties related to false positives.
